Output 3b68174ce188c51ee67ff39f2ee1eeb9df377a8b4e09b4128d9b993af45a698d:0

value
525770281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44c1e92e81804c314be4934d4cd5d13cf8ee627 OP_EQUAL
address
3J8LjwhUrbDkh5RwJEqN5ZjbcjPyxsPUhU
transaction
3b68174ce188c51ee67ff39f2ee1eeb9df377a8b4e09b4128d9b993af45a698d
spent
true